单片机io端口怎么算
单片机 i/o 端口数量由以下因素计算:数据总线宽度 / 每端口引脚数。例如,对于具有 8 位数据总线和 8 个引脚的并行端口,i/o 端口数量为 8 位 / 8 引脚 = 1,即一个 8 位并行端口。
单片机 I/O 端口的计算
单片机 I/O(输入/输出)端口是连接外部设备和微处理器的接口,负责输入和输出数据。通常,I/O 端口由一系列引脚组成,每个引脚可以独立设置输入或输出。
计算方法
要计算单片机的 I/O 端口,需要考虑以下因素:
数据总线宽度:确定微处理器数据总线可以处理的位数(例如 8 位或 16 位)。端口类型:识别不同类型的 I/O 端口,例如并行端口和串行端口。每端口引脚数:确定每个 I/O 端口包含的引脚数。
公式
给定上述因素,可以根据以下公式计算 I/O 端口:
I/O 端口数量 = (数据总线宽度 / 每端口引脚数)
示例
例如,对于具有 8 位数据总线和 8 个引脚的并行端口的单片机,I/O 端口数量为:
I/O 端口数量 = (8 位 / 8 引脚) = 1
因此,该单片机有一个 8 位并行端口,包含 8 个引脚。
以上就是单片机io端口怎么算的详细内容,更多请关注范的app.fanyaozu.com资源库其它相关文章!
引用来源:https://app.fanyaozu.com/400314.html
转载请注明:范的资源库 » 单片机io端口怎么算